IEA Hedge Fund Activity: Q3 2021 in Review

105 of the 5,713 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Infrastructure and Energy Alternatives, Inc. Common Stock (IEA) for Q3 2021, worth a combined $390M — up 89% from $206M a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 36 funds opened new IEA positions and 12 closed out — a net gain of 24 holders — while 43 added to existing stakes and 15 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Ares Management, opening a new position worth an estimated $145M. The largest seller was Invesco, cutting an estimated $6.62M.
